## Session Token Refresh Bug — Limits & Quotas

Heads up, support folks: the Quillgate auth service has a known bug where session tokens refresh early under load, which burns through the per-user refresh quota faster than expected. Users then see "too many refresh attempts" even with normal usage. We've bumped quotas as a stopgap while the Brindlewood team ships a real fix. If a customer hits this, check their refresh count first. The current tuning constants are below.

limits module of tafop-hahop:
WEIGHTS = {
    "julmir": 223,
    "belox": 987,
    "lamion": 470,
    "pelath": 609,
    "fraok": 1010,
    "eliion": 343,
    "drudor": 342,
}

Subject: Cut-over summary — drift compensation

Cut-over of the Fernhall greenhouse controller finished at 04:10. Humidity sensor drift exceeded tolerance on bays 3–7; the new Verdanix firmware applies rolling recalibration every six hours. Old controllers are powered off, credentials rotated, audit logging enabled end to end. No anomalies during the switch. For review, the production controllers now run with the following configuration:

deployment values, kajep-kageg:
[praix]
host = praix.paliqcorp.corp
user = praix_svc
database = praix_prod

Handover note — Crumbwheel order cutoffs.

Welcome aboard. The bakery cutoff rule in Crumbwheel closes same-day orders at 14:00 local to each storefront, not UTC — this has bitten us twice. Holiday overrides live in the calendar service and take precedence silently, so always check there first when a cutoff looks wrong. To unlock the calendar service's admin console after a restart, enter the recovery passphrase below.

vault phrase of bagap-bahaf = silion-pelox-sorox-casdor-quenwyn-fraax-eliox-praael-kelion-quenvan-kasox-rusael-norius-belvan

**Q: How is the Ferngate garage occupancy feed protected, and what happens if the publisher key is lost?**

Good question—the feed itself is read-only telemetry, so the main risk is spoofed occupancy counts. The publisher key lives in the Corvand escrow vault, and only two reviewers can trigger a restore. If a restore is approved, the escrow console prompts for the recovery passphrase below.

unlock words, kagef-taduf: fenir-quenix-norwyn-sorvan-gormir-gorir-fraok